Table with columns: Metric, This model, Original model (Qwen/Qwen2.5-Coder-0.5B-Instruct)| Metric | This model | Original model (Qwen/Qwen2.5-Coder-0.5B-Instruct) |
|---|
| KL divergence | 0.1249 | 0 (by definition) |
| Refusals | 8/100 | 52/100 |
KL divergence of 0.12 on the output distribution is low — the edit is narrow and targeted rather than a broad perturbation. Refusals dropped from 52 to 8 out of 100 adversarial prompts, meaning the model complies while retaining nearly all of its original capabilities.

Responsible use
Refusal suppression is deliberate and works as intended: this model will comply with requests the base model would refuse, including some it shouldn't. There is no safety filtering layered on top. You are responsible for how you deploy it — don't put this behind an unmoderated public-facing endpoint serving third parties. It inherits Qwen2.5-Coder-0.5B-Instruct's factual limitations and biases; abliteration removes refusal directions, it doesn't add capability or judgment.
